Job Description:
As a Senior User Experience Designer with a strong focus on accessibility, you will play a key role in managing the responsibilities and overseeing the workload of an internal accessibility audit that is designed to bring our website to full compliance. Your work will ensure that all UI components and interactions are fully accessible, compliant with WCAG 2.1, ADA, and Section 508 guidelines, and meet the needs of users with various disabilities. You will be responsible for crafting UI elements within a design system, and ensuring that accessibility is seamlessly integrated into every stage of the design process. This is a fully remote position and will need to be accessible during regular working hours.

KEY RESPONSIBILITIES:
Accessibility-First UI Design:
  • Work with the auditing team at the oversite of the User Experience Manager to refine user interfaces with a high attention-to-detail on meeting strict accessibility standards, including WCAG 2.1, ADA, Section 508, and other relevant guidelines. A fully comprehensive understanding of these standards will be necessary to analyze, review and interpret which areas of our website will need to be updated to meet these strict accessibility standards. Fluency in Figma and a fully comprehensive understanding of user interface design is a cornerstone of this position.
  • Create and maintain highly accessible, reusable UI components within a design system that support consistency and scalability across platforms. Understanding how to structurally design components for accessibility at the presentation layer is extremely important.
  • Ensure that all components are visually accessible (color contrast, typography, spacing) and functionally accessible (keyboard navigation, screen reader compatibility).

Component Creation & Maintenance:
  • Design, build, and update UI components (e.g., buttons, forms, modals, navigation) to ensure they comply with contemporary accessibility best practices.
  • Work closely with cross-functional teams, especially front-end developers, to ensure that the components you design are properly implemented and remain fully accessible throughout the development cycle.

Design System Accessibility:
  • Act as the lead on integrating accessibility into our design system, ensuring all components are documented and accessible to designers and developers alike.
  • Ensure that design system annotations for accessibility are clear, practical, and up-to-date, empowering other team members to create compliant and inclusive interfaces.
  • Audit the design system for all perceivable, operable, understandable and robust potential accessibility gaps and drive the effort in making improvements based on the latest standards and guidelines including the 400% reflow.

Figma Mastery & Component Documentation:
  • Use Figma as the primary tool for creating high-fidelity UI components and prototypes, ensuring they adhere to accessibility standards.
  • Manage component libraries within Figma, ensuring all assets are well-organized, easy to use, and aligned with accessibility best practices.
  • Provide clear, accessible documentation for every component, outlining how to use them in an accessible context and integrating accessibility features from the ground up.

Accessibility Audits & Testing:
  • Ability to work within and understand the responsibility of accessibility audits of existing designs, using tools like Figma, Storybook, Lighthouse, and manual testing to ensure compliance with WCAG and other accessibility guidelines.
  • Identify, report, and resolve accessibility issues in designs, recommending solutions and updates to improve the overall accessibility of the product.

Cross-functional Collaboration & Advocacy:
  • Work closely with developers, product managers, and other designers to integrate accessibility into every aspect of the design and development process.
  • Act as an accessibility advocate within the organization, educating stakeholders and raising awareness of the importance of inclusive design.
  • Ensure that accessibility is considered during the early stages of product development, not as an afterthought.

REQUIRED QUALIFICATIONS:
  • 5+ years of experience as a UX/UI Designer with a strong focus on accessibility in design.
  • Proven track record of creating and maintaining UI components that meet strict accessibility standards, including WCAG 2.1, ADA, and Section 508.
  • Expert knowledge of accessibility guidelines and principles, and how they apply to UI design (color contrast, keyboard navigation, screen readers, etc.).
  • Strong portfolio showcasing work focused on accessibility, including UI components and design systems that adhere to accessibility standards.
  • Advanced proficiency in Figma, including managing component libraries, creating high-fidelity prototypes, and submitting accessible components.
  • Knowledge of assistive technologies (e.g., screen readers, voice recognition, magnification tools) and their integration with digital products.
  • Solid understanding of how to design for users with various disabilities, including visual, auditory, cognitive, and motor impairments.
  • Excellent communication skills, with the ability to clearly advocate for accessibility and explain complex concepts to non-designers.
  • Fluency working within a project management system such as Jira, Asana or other similar software.
  • Experience working with cross-functional teams, including developers, to ensure seamless implementation of accessible designs.

PREFERRED QUALIFICATIONS:
  • Experience with front-end development or a deep understanding of the development process to ensure accessibility compliance during implementation.
  • Experience conducting accessibility audits using tools like Lighthouse, or similar tools, and providing actionable recommendations to improve accessibility.
  • Familiarity with version control systems or design system management tools (e.g., Zeroheight, Storybook).
  • Experience with Agile methodologies and working in collaborative, fast-paced environments.
  • Familiarity with accessibility testing tools like JAWS, NVDA, or VoiceOver.
